An electrical circuit where the current is unable to flow due to a break is known as what?

Explanation:
An electrical circuit where the current is unable to flow due to a break is known as an open circuit. In an open circuit, there is a gap or break in the path that prevents electrons from completing their journey through the circuit. This interruption can occur due to a variety of reasons, such as a switch being turned off, a wire being cut, or a component being removed. When the circuit is open, devices connected to it will not operate, as there is no continuous loop for the electrical current to follow. In contrast, a short circuit typically refers to a situation where an unintended path allows current to flow outside of its intended circuit, often leading to excessive current that can cause damage. A closed circuit indicates that the path is complete and current can flow as intended, enabling devices to function. Lastly, a bypass circuit is designed to redirect current from the main circuit to another path, but it doesn’t pertain to the concept of an interruption in flow due to a break. Thus, the term open circuit specifically defines a condition where current flow is halted due to a break in the circuit.
